Alex Iafallo scored two goals for the Kings. Los Angeles has a 13-6-3 record versus the Pacific Division and an overall record of 45-22-10. The Kings have 260 goals scored overall and 239 goals allowed, giving them a +21 goal difference. Edmonton is 15-6-1 against the Pacific Division and has an overall record of 45-23-9. The Oilers lead the league with 306 goals overall (4. 0 per game). Tuesday's matchup will be the fourth encounter between these teams this year.
